MIDI
bron: http://susehelp.l4l.be/multimedia/midi.html ,Frederik Vos
Dit document is bedoeld als algemene uitleg over wat MIDI is.
Begin tachtiger jaren ontstond bij muzikanten de behoefte dat elekronische muziek-instrumenten (van digitale instrumenten was nog niet echt sprake), met elkaar konden communiceren. Hiervoor werd het MIDI protocol ontwikkeld.
De basis van MIDI is niet veel meer dan note aan/uit informatie, iets wat uiteraard voor computers een gemakkelijke zaak is (kwestie van een 0 of een 1 is niks anders dan het binaire stelsel. Ook werden er steeds meer controllers (aansturen van sustain, kiezen van geluiden, tempo etc) aanstuurbaar via MIDI.
Van compatibiliteit was nog weinig sprake, wat de communicatie bemoeilijkte. In 1991 werd GM versie 1 daarom uitgevonden: een afspraak rond welke instrumenten en in welke volgorde, en dit eveneens voor de controllers. Een update verscheen eind 2003 met GM2. Volledig bevredigend was de GM standaard niet, vooral te beperkt. Roland is later daarom gekomen met GS. De laatste ontwikkeling is XG, waar vooral Yamaha een rol in gespeeld heeft.
Voor de computer was Atari een van de koplopers, maar ook pc's werden vrij snel met een midi interface uitbreidbaar. Voor Roland heeft hierbij met zijn MPU-401 een standaard gezet. Linux ondersteund per definitie alle MPU-401 compatibele kaarten. Maar in feite is een MIDI interface gewoon een implementatie van een serieel protocol, die zelfs relatief eenvoudig zelf te bouwen is. Aangezien het een serieel protocol is en USB dat eveneens is, is het niet verwonderlijk dat veel interfaces tegenwoordig aangesloten worden via de usb poort.
Midi kan voor een aantal zaken gebruikt worden:
Communicatie tussen instrumenten (dus ook pc) waardoor je bijv. vanaf 1 instrument de rest kan aansturen
Muziek opnemen met behulp van een zogenaamde midi-sequenser. Afspelen gaat uiteraard ook.
Programmeren van instrumenten, en uiteraard die configuraties naar de instrumenten sturen en ontvangen, waarbij je deze ook kunt opslaan. (Midi System Exlusive)
Hulpmiddel bij muzieknotatie
Hoewel het gebruikt kan worden voor opnames zullen semi en prof. muzikanten snel schakelen naar audio, omdat je hierbij veel meer kan en dit ook exact opneemt wat je speelt, terwijl midi hier zijn beperkingen bij kent.
Succes.
bron: http://susehelp.l4l.be/multimedia/midi.html ,Frederik Vos
Dit document is bedoeld als algemene uitleg over wat MIDI is.
Begin tachtiger jaren ontstond bij muzikanten de behoefte dat elekronische muziek-instrumenten (van digitale instrumenten was nog niet echt sprake), met elkaar konden communiceren. Hiervoor werd het MIDI protocol ontwikkeld.
De basis van MIDI is niet veel meer dan note aan/uit informatie, iets wat uiteraard voor computers een gemakkelijke zaak is (kwestie van een 0 of een 1 is niks anders dan het binaire stelsel. Ook werden er steeds meer controllers (aansturen van sustain, kiezen van geluiden, tempo etc) aanstuurbaar via MIDI.
Van compatibiliteit was nog weinig sprake, wat de communicatie bemoeilijkte. In 1991 werd GM versie 1 daarom uitgevonden: een afspraak rond welke instrumenten en in welke volgorde, en dit eveneens voor de controllers. Een update verscheen eind 2003 met GM2. Volledig bevredigend was de GM standaard niet, vooral te beperkt. Roland is later daarom gekomen met GS. De laatste ontwikkeling is XG, waar vooral Yamaha een rol in gespeeld heeft.
Voor de computer was Atari een van de koplopers, maar ook pc's werden vrij snel met een midi interface uitbreidbaar. Voor Roland heeft hierbij met zijn MPU-401 een standaard gezet. Linux ondersteund per definitie alle MPU-401 compatibele kaarten. Maar in feite is een MIDI interface gewoon een implementatie van een serieel protocol, die zelfs relatief eenvoudig zelf te bouwen is. Aangezien het een serieel protocol is en USB dat eveneens is, is het niet verwonderlijk dat veel interfaces tegenwoordig aangesloten worden via de usb poort.
Midi kan voor een aantal zaken gebruikt worden:
Communicatie tussen instrumenten (dus ook pc) waardoor je bijv. vanaf 1 instrument de rest kan aansturen
Muziek opnemen met behulp van een zogenaamde midi-sequenser. Afspelen gaat uiteraard ook.
Programmeren van instrumenten, en uiteraard die configuraties naar de instrumenten sturen en ontvangen, waarbij je deze ook kunt opslaan. (Midi System Exlusive)
Hulpmiddel bij muzieknotatie
Hoewel het gebruikt kan worden voor opnames zullen semi en prof. muzikanten snel schakelen naar audio, omdat je hierbij veel meer kan en dit ook exact opneemt wat je speelt, terwijl midi hier zijn beperkingen bij kent.
Succes.





